Dr. Philomina Okeke-Ihejirika

Dr. Philomina Okeke-Ihejirika

Director, Pan-African Collaboration for Excellence

Philomina Okeke-Ihejirika is a Full Professor in U of A’s Women’s and Gender Studies Department. Over the course of her 25-year academic career, Dr. Okeke-Ihejirika has worked on research projects, program planning, graduate and professional training among other initiatives related to gender issues in Africa, Canada and other parts of the world. Her publication track record reflects extensive knowledge of transnational, post-colonial, and intersectional feminist approaches.
